HB 465

UT 2024 R Affordable housing incentives and financing, Publicly-owned

Provided by Furman

Summary

  • Encourages the Point of the Mountain State Land Authority to contribute to increasing the supply of housing in the state if appropriate.
    • Expands the definition of income targeted housing to include housing owned and occupied by households making up to 120 percent of the area median income in addition to housing occupied by households making up to 80 percent of the area median income.
    • Authorizes the Department of Workforce Services to create pass-through funding agreements with housing organizations controlled by nonprofits that manage a portfolio of investments dedicated to the preservation of affordable housing.
